The final bill for painting your home depends on a few moving parts. First, consider the total surface area and the number of stories. Larger homes or those with tricky architectural features naturally require more labor and specialized equipment. The condition of your siding is another big factor; if there is significant wood rot, peeling paint, or heavy mildew, those areas need extra prep work before a brush ever touches the wall.
